Shelbyville junior Shia Veach has been named the Beth Prince State Farm Athlete of the Week.
Veach continued his strong cross country season Saturday at the Whiteland Invitational, earning a first-place finish in 16:12.
The SHS boys cross country team finished fifth overall, which is its best finish at the Whiteland Invitational since 2019.
Veach's best time this season came on Sept. 6 at the Rick Weinheimer Invitational. He finished in 16:08 (27th place, large school division).
